[asterisk-bugs] [Asterisk 0014877]: pri_resolve_span assumes span's channels have consecutive numbers
Asterisk Bug Tracker
noreply at bugs.digium.com
Wed Oct 7 18:13:59 CDT 2009
The following issue requires your FEEDBACK.
======================================================================
https://issues.asterisk.org/view.php?id=14877
======================================================================
Reported By: tzafrir
Assigned To: jpeeler
======================================================================
Project: Asterisk
Issue ID: 14877
Category: Channels/chan_dahdi
Reproducibility: have not tried
Severity: minor
Priority: normal
Status: feedback
Asterisk Version: SVN
JIRA:
Regression: No
Reviewboard Link:
SVN Branch (only for SVN checkouts, not tarball releases): trunk
SVN Revision (number only!): 187963
Request Review:
======================================================================
Date Submitted: 2009-04-11 09:01 CDT
Last Modified: 2009-10-07 18:13 CDT
======================================================================
Summary: pri_resolve_span assumes span's channels have
consecutive numbers
Description:
pri_resolve-span assumes that the the D channel of a span is at channel
number <base> + 16 / 24 / 3 (for E1/ T1/J1 / BRI, respectively).
This is normalyl the case. But does not apply if channels of the span do
not have consecutive numbers. Which is something that can happen with the
right order of modules loading / unloading sequence in a multi-device
system.
Furthermore, when the function is called it is called with the following
value for the parameter 'offset':
channel - p.chanpos
Thus making this assumption again.
======================================================================
----------------------------------------------------------------------
(0112033) jpeeler (administrator) - 2009-10-07 18:13
https://issues.asterisk.org/view.php?id=14877#c112033
----------------------------------------------------------------------
I loaded a quad-span as T1 and then loaded another card. I then unloaded
the T1 module, reloaded as E1, reconfigured chan_dahdi with the new channel
numberings, and everything seemed to work fine.
Tzafrir: Have you been able to find a problem with chan_dahdi configured
with the nonconsecutive channels?
Issue History
Date Modified Username Field Change
======================================================================
2009-10-07 18:13 jpeeler Note Added: 0112033
2009-10-07 18:13 jpeeler Status assigned => feedback
======================================================================
More information about the asterisk-bugs
mailing list